Video: Mourinho Rubbishes Gerrard’s Claims Of His Friction With Chelsea FC Captain John Terry

August 16, 2019 9:39 pm
Reading Time: 2 mins read
Share on XShare on Facebook


.

Chelsea FC manager Jose Mourinho rubbished Liverpool FC legend Steven Gerrard’s claim that John Terry was dropped last night because of friction between the Portuguese and the former England international.

When a team starts to lose games, all sorts of rumors start to emerge. Following Chelsea FC’s poor start to the season, rumors were beginning to emerge of a conflict between Jose Mourinho and John Terry, after the latter was substituted at half time in the 3-0 defeat to Manchester City in the second game of the season.

Terry was dropped from the Champions League game last night, leading to the suggestion made by new BT Sport analyst Steven Gerrard that it might potentially be due to the relationship between Terry and Mourinho souring.

However, following the 4-0 win over Maccabi Tel-Aviv, the Portuguese rubbished those claims, while maintaining that he is still close to the current LA Galaxy man.
